Dillon, Letters lead Lehigh to sweep in Ann Arbor

11/23/2003 12:00:00 AM | Men's Wrestling

Ann Arbor, MI – With a preseason ranking as high as No. 2 in the nation, expectations were high for this year’s Lehigh wrestling team. A season-opening loss to No. 6 Iowa State did a little to dampen enthusiasm, but on Sunday the Mountain Hawks did all they could to justify their high standing, defeating the No. 4 Michigan Wolverines (1-1) on their home floor by a final of 18-12. Earlier in the day, Lehigh (3-1) defeated No. 15 Central Michigan (0-2) 25-9 as well.

The match started at 125, where Mario Stuart knocked off his second top ten opponent in 10 days, this one 9-7 over Michigan's Mark Moos. He did it in the same comeback fashion, trailing 4-3 after one period, 6-5 after the second, and then diving for his winning takedown at the edge with just twenty seconds left in the final two minutes.  At 133, Matt Ciasulli showed off his dominance on time, defeating Chase Metcalf 5-4 thanks to a 2:38 riding time advantage.
            Another wild bout occurred at 141, where Cory Cooperman whipped No. 15 Clark Forward, 13-8. Tied at 2-2 after one period and 4-4 after the second, Cooperman was able to gain three takedowns in the decisive period for the big win.  The win was a big turnaround from last November, as the Mountain Hawks got out to a 9-0 lead after trailing as much as 23-0 last year at Grace Hall.
            Making his varsity debut on the mat at 149 at last was Matt Anderson, who lost 4-2 to No. 6 Ryan Churella but had him on his back at the end in a near fall cradle.
Anderson won by forfeit in the earlier match to Central Michigan.
            Two All-Americans matched up at 157, with defending NCAA champion Ryan Bertin beating Derek Zinck. Zinck scored the first takedown in the first period, but Bertin took control and took the victory 7-4. Troy Letters then scored a five-point counter move in the first period (takedown and three-point near fall) against Pat Owen at 165 and added a third period reversal plus time advantage to win 8-3. Brad Dillon was up next at 174, and the senior co-captain remained undefeated with a 7-3 victory of his own.
            Travis Frick gave his team an 18-6 lead with a 3-2 win at 184, thanks to an oh-so-slim
1:07 riding time advantage.  This meant that Michigan could win only by tying the dual 18-18 with two falls and winning on criteria. Michigan would fight back, but Matt Cassidy hung tough at 197 to lose by a close 3-2 margin to Chase Verdoorn and clinch the victory for the Mountain Hawks.  Cassidy was again the Cardiac Kid, as even in his first loss his match was decided by a single point.  Greg Warner then finished the match by defeating Paul Weibel 10-3 at heavyweight.

Coach Greg Strobel was happy to come away with the sweep. “We could have come out of there 0-2 against two such good teams,” said Strobel. “So getting two wins is quite an accomplishment for this team. Last year we trailed so bad so early to Michigan, so it was a little surprising to see us up 9-0 after the first three matches. So now we just have to get ready for Hawaii

The 18-12 win was all the more impressive, considering the Mountain Hawks wrestled Central Michigan directly beforehand. Lehigh defeated the Chippewas 25-9, winning at seven of the ten weights. Among the winners for the Mountain Hawks, Derek Zinck took the only non minor decision of the day, beating Ty Morgan 14-4 at 157 for a major decision.  Troy Letters faced his toughest match so far, needing overtime to defeat David Bolyard 4-2 at 165.  Matt Cassidy also won a tight one, escaping with one second left to win his match 4-3 at 197.

Lehigh will continue their season as they travel to Hawaii over Thanksgiving to face Oregon State in the Aloha Duals. The action gets under way on Friday, November 28.
